The more, the merrier
Image shared under CC0
Martha invited all of her friends to the
New Year’s party. The more, the merrier!
the more people or things there are, the better or more enjoyable a situation will be.
White Christmasa traditional Christmas during which there is snow on the
ground.

Mariam always dreamt of a White Christmas. She couldn’t wait to move to Canada to
finally have one!
Spread the joy express positive energy and make everyone around you
feel happy

Everyone was spreading the joy by
signing carols and having snowball
fights.
Cuddle up with someone to sit or lie very close to someone and put
your arms around them
